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1203 connectés 

  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  Requete SQL

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

Requete SQL

n°2157779
jerem4579
Posté le 22-09-2012 à 16:03:05  profilanswer
 

Bonjour j'ai besoin d'un petit coup de main pour quelques requêtes SQL
 
Nombre de livres par auteur
Afficher la liste des livres en rupture de stock, ordonné par genre.
Nombre de livres par auteur, on ne retiendra que ceux qui ont  plusieurs livres.
 
Il n'y pas besoin de jointure il n'y que une seul table et c'est sous Access

mood
Publicité
Posté le 22-09-2012 à 16:03:05  profilanswer
 

n°2157782
boomy29
PSN: tintine29
Posté le 22-09-2012 à 16:22:54  profilanswer
 

donne la liste des champs de la table se sera plus simple
 
select count(livre) , auteur from table group by auteur  
select * from table where rupture = 1 order by genre  
select count(livre) as Nbligne , auteur from table where Nbligne >1 group by auteur  
 
a voir c'est du SQL ça je sais pas si c'est bon pour access
et sur la dernière c'est pas bon je pense il y aura un soucis dans la clause mais j'ai pas de SQL sous la main pour tester  
et je suis plus s'il faut pas mettre livre dans la group by aussi


Message édité par boomy29 le 22-09-2012 à 22:20:36
n°2157809
Soileh
Lurkeur professionnel
Posté le 23-09-2012 à 08:29:10  profilanswer
 

Pour la dernière, c'est une requête du style :
 

Code :
  1. SELECT count(livre), auteur
  2. FROM table
  3. HAVING count(livre) > 1
  4. GROUP BY auteur


 :jap:


---------------
And in the end, the love you take is equal to the love you make
n°2157813
boomy29
PSN: tintine29
Posté le 23-09-2012 à 10:14:59  profilanswer
 

Bien vu c'est ça  
mais la clause having se met après la clause group by ;)

n°2157838
Soileh
Lurkeur professionnel
Posté le 23-09-2012 à 12:47:33  profilanswer
 

Ah ça peut-être, je me suis fié à ma mémoire  [:cupra]


---------------
And in the end, the love you take is equal to the love you make

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  Requete SQL

 

Sujets relatifs
Temps d'éxécution requête Oracle Sql trop longue[Résolu] Simplification de requete SQL
Requete SQL double résultatAppel aux dieux du SQL, à vos claviers ! ( optimisation requête... )
Requête SQL - Position dans un classementAide pour requete SQL
Stocker les étapes d'une requête SQL en tableRequête SQL avec jointure
[SQL] Optimisation de requête sqlRequête PL/SQL
Plus de sujets relatifs à : Requete SQL


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R